What is a Google Security Clearance job?

A Google Security Clearance job typically requires candidates to hold a U.S. government security clearance, as these roles involve working on sensitive projects related to national security, defense, or classified government contracts. Employees in these positions must undergo background checks and adhere to strict security protocols. These jobs may involve cybersecurity, infrastructure protection, or confidential data analysis, often within Google’s cloud, AI, or defense-related divisions.

Dark Wolf is looking for a Google Workspace Engineer who is interested in working in a fast-paced environment supporting and maintaining a large-scale Google Workspace environment for a DoD customer. The successful candidate will work in collaboration with the customer's security team and will be responsible for implementing security best practices for Google Workspace to include designing and architecting solutions to secure services, monitoring Workspace services, and responding to incidents. This position will also offer the opportunity for the successful candidate to expand their role into greater responsibilities such as Cloud and Platform Security Engineering.

Key Responsibilities: * Administer all services within the Workspace suite: Gmail, Drive, Docs, etc. * Design and implement data loss prevention (DLP) controls for Workspace content * Implement Gmail filtering controls to detect and quarantine sensitive content * Perform Incident response on across all Workspace services * Document and present security best practices and designs to Customer stakeholders Required Qualifications: * 5+ years of System Administration experience for Education, Enterprise or Federal Government customers * 2+ System Administration experience for Google Workspace or similar SaaS office suite platform (e.g. Microsoft 365) * Experience supporting user requests and troubleshooting issues * Experience with DoD/DISA cybersecurity policies * US Citizenship and the ability to obtain a Secret security clearance Desired Qualifications: *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science of related field * Professional Google Workspace Administrator Certificate * Experience operating and maintaining systems on Google Cloud Platform (GCP), Amazon Web Services (AWS), or Microsoft Azure * Knowledge of the Risk Management Framework (RMF) accreditation process and security requirements * Knowledge of Google Apps Manager (GAM) This position will be a remote/hybrid role based out of multiple hubs including: Herndon, VA, Tampa, FL, Huntsville, AL, Colorado Springs, CO, Ogden, UT, and Omaha, NE.

The salary range for this position is estimated to be between $70,000.00 - $135,000.00, commensurate on experience and technical skillset.
